Job description
Are you passionate about working in healthcare?

We currently have some exciting opportunities for Band 3 Healthcare Assistants and Healthcare Apprentices to work at our Trust.

Our teams require colleagues who are reliable, competent, and conscientious with the ability to work as part of a staff team, having good skills in communication is a must! It is important that applicants can demonstrate confidence in supporting individuals who may present with complex challenging behaviour.

Don’t worry if you are not yet qualified as we are also looking for remarkable candidates to join our Healthcare Apprenticeship programme, where you will being your career as Band 2 Healthcare assistant whilst you will attain a level 3 qualification and once completed you will become a Band 3 Health Care Assistant

At the end of the programme, you will be equipped with the knowledge, understanding, skills, attitudes and behaviours relevant to employment as a Health Care Assistant and will work to a nationally recognised code of conduct.

The Trust is an extraordinary place to undertake an apprenticeship programme. We have helped many local people gain invaluable experience of working in the NHS, along with achieving a nationally recognised qualification.

You are expected to have an understanding of the principles of Transforming care and be key in its implementation within our services. You will have a good understanding of person-centred care and be able to demonstrate this throughout your practice.

Applicants must demonstrate qualities including compassion, courage, and care. Experience of supporting individuals is important. You will be expected to work under supervision and direction with the confidence and ability to use own initiative as required.

Main duties include but not limited to
  • • Delivering personal care to patients
  • Dealing with potential and actual conflict situations which may include the use of Trust approved DMI techniques
  • Undertaking basic physical observations and supportive engagements of patients.
  • Liaising with teams within our Trust
  • Liaising with families and carers.
